UB Welcomes New Therapist, Anna Kultys, LCPC to Evanston Office

Anna Kultys is a Licensed Clinical Professional Counselor with experience in both clinical and forensic settings. She believes that a healthy lifestyle consists of both emotional and physical well-being. She approaches therapy with an open mind, empathic attitude, and dedication to engaging with patients in taking ownership of their goals. To that end, sessions focus on awareness, acceptance, and motivation towards change. Her key areas of clinical expertise consist of cognitive behavioral and existential treatment of depression, anxiety, stress, coping with trauma, work related matters, and immigration/acculturation issues. Anna’s experience is drawn from having worked with adults in community and private mental health settings as well as within the context of medicolegal evaluations. She earned her Master’s degree in Forensic Psychology at the Chicago School of Professional Psychology and her Bachelor’s degree from the University of Illinois at Urbana-Champaign. Anna is also fluent in the Polish language and culture.
